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49 47849 06881060 402837851 37661
252113133 6802 70114151766
252113133 6802 70114151766
04 937654243 347
All about undefined
Interested in learning more?
252113133 6802 70114151766
04 937654243 347
See more
5970875 533 3090127
674 898 97986054600
See more
9270001 53592823731 033224
1734835 544898653 21
See more